Job Function

  • Performs assessments of systems and networks within the network environment or enclave and identifies where those systems/networks deviate from acceptable configurations, policies, or guidance. Measures effectiveness of defense-in-depth architecture against known vulnerabilities.
  • Assists with risk assessments, and development of security architecture solutions and technologies.
  • Supports development of detailed proposals and plans for new information security systems and controls to enhance or enable new capabilities for network or hosted applications.
  • Conducts ongoing compliance reviews; assists in developing practices to ensure adequate information security and IT controls.
Essential Functions
  • Performs information security risk assessments and recommends mitigating controls and solutions for IT and Operations Technology (OT) projects and applications, including proposals for externally hosted applications and new utility technology projects.
  • Assists with the system assessments for conformance with configuration control, policy, and guidance.
  • Assists with program development and management for privacy, e‑discovery, security awareness training, digital forensics, vulnerability remediation, and other security and compliance programs.
  • Performs miscellaneous administrative roles such as schedule development, information tracking, updating deliverables and other work assigned.
  • Supports the Company’s business continuity planning, IT disaster recovery planning, cybersecurity incident response planning and team (CS-IMT), with occasional on‑call support.
  • Participates in Company emergency response activities as assigned, including any activities required to prepare for such emergency response.
Knowledge Requirements
  • Computer networking concepts and protocols, and network security methodologies.
  • Risk management processes (e.g., methods for assessing and mitigating risk).
  • Cybersecurity and privacy principles and organizational requirements (relevant to confidentiality, integrity, availability, authentication, non‑repudiation).
  • Laws, regulations, policies, and ethics as they relate to cybersecurity and privacy.
  • Cyber threats and vulnerabilities.
  • Cryptography and cryptographic key management concepts.
  • Data backup and recovery concepts.
  • Host/network access control mechanisms (e.g., access control list, capabilities list).
  • Network access, identity, and access management (e.g., public key infrastructure, Oauth, OpenID, SAML, SPML).
  • Traffic flows across the network (e.g., Transmission Control Protocol [TCP] and Internet Protocol [IP], Open System Interconnection Model [OSI], Information Technology Infrastructure Library, current version [ITIL]).
  • Programming language structures and logic.
  • System and application security threats and vulnerabilities (e.g., buffer overflow, mobile code, cross‑site scripting, Procedural Language/Structured Query Language [PL/SQL] and injections, race conditions, covert channel, replay, return‑oriented attacks, malicious code).
  • Network attacks and a network attack’s relationship to both threats and vulnerabilities.
  • System administration, network, and operating system hardening techniques.
  • Different classes of attacks (e.g., passive, active, insider, close‑in, distribution attacks).
  • Different cyber attackers (e.g., script kiddies, insider threat, non‑nation state sponsored, and nation sponsored).
  • Different cyber‑attack stages (e.g., reconnaissance, scanning, enumeration, gaining access, escalation of privileges, maintaining access, network exploitation, covering tracks, etc.).
  • Network security architecture concepts including topology, protocols, components, and principles (e.g., application of defense‑in‑depth).
  • Specific operational impacts of cybersecurity lapses.
  • Security models (e.g., Bell‑LaPadula model, Biba integrity model, Clark‑Wilson integrity model).
  • Ethical hacking principles and techniques.
  • Penetration testing principles, tools, and techniques.
